摘 要(英文):Dynamics of energy dist ribution and it s production of a Pinus massoniana community in Dinghushan Biosphere Reserve were studied over a ten year period f rom 1990 to 2000. Gross caloric value was estimated to be 19. 34 kJ / g for t ree (range 19. 02~20. 30 kJ / g) ,17. 82 kJ / g for shrub (16. 55~18. 78 kJ / g) ,and 15. 03 for
herb (range 13. 07~16. 16 kJ / g) . The standing crop of energy was 167 141. 4 kJ / m2 (1990) ,270 295. 9 kJ / m2
(1995) and 321 294. 3 kJ / m2 (2000) ,with t ree accounting for 93.4 % ,79. 8 % and 86. 7 % , respectively. Netenergy production was 17 083. 2 kJ / m2 . a for the period f rom 1990~1995 and 21 571. 8 kJ / m2 . a for the periodf rom 1995~2000 ,of which 96. 6 % and 95. 5 % was cont ributed by t ree ,the rest by under story plant . Of totalnet energy production ,72. 7 %(during1990~1995) and 57. 6 %(during 1995~2000) was accumulated as bio-mass energy ,and 27. 3 %(during 1990~1995) and 42. 4 %(during 1995~2000) was returned to soil by litter-fall . Relative to the photosynthetic active radiation on the stand ,the energy conver sing efficiency of P. masso-niana community was 0. 759 %for the period of 1990~1995 , 0. 958% for the period of 1995~2000 ,with a to-tal mean of 01873% for the period of 1990~2000. The current management for pine forest in Dinghushan Bio-sphere Reserve was al so discussed based on the result s of this study.
